Why a Nurses & Healthcare Workers Community Website Is Essential

Nurses and healthcare workers dedicate their careers to helping others, yet often lack a dedicated space to connect beyond their workplaces. A community website provides a focused hub where professionals can share experiences, seek advice, discuss industry trends, and find emotional support from peers who understand the demands of healthcare.

In an era of increasing digital interaction, an online platform becomes a vital tool for professional networking and growth. A well-structured website provides centralized hubs for discussions, mentorship programs, and job listings, and by fostering collaboration, it ultimately contributes to better patient care and a stronger healthcare workforce.

What Makes a Great Healthcare Community Website?

A successful healthcare community website needs to be more than a forum. It should offer a strong user experience, meaningful engagement features, and a safe environment for open professional discussions. Key elements include:

  • Intuitive design with clear navigation
  • Private member profiles with professional information
  • Discussion boards organized by specialty or topic
  • Private messaging and group workspaces
  • Strong security measures and data protection
  • Mobile accessibility for busy healthcare schedules

How to Set Up Your Healthcare Community Website

1. Install WordPress and BuddyX Pro

Start with a domain that reflects your community, choose reliable hosting, and install WordPress. Then activate BuddyX Pro and configure the community layout, colors, and branding. Install BuddyPress and set up member profiles and groups.

2. Configure membership and privacy settings

Decide whether the community will be public, private, or invite-only. For healthcare professionals, a verified private community is often more trusted and valuable. Configure moderation tools and SSL encryption to protect member data and maintain a safe space.

3. Create organized discussion boards

Set up dedicated discussion boards by specialty or topic, patient care, mental health support, nursing education, career development, clinical research. Organized topics make the community navigable and ensure members find relevant conversations.

What Content to Include

Content is the backbone of any successful community. Mix content formats to keep members engaged:

  • Blog posts and research articles on clinical topics
  • Video tutorials and recorded webinars
  • Downloadable e-books, career guides, and industry reports
  • Case studies and professional experience sharing
  • Guest contributions from experienced nurses, administrators, and medical experts

How to Promote Your Healthcare Community Website

Promote through LinkedIn, Facebook Groups, and nursing-specific associations. Collaborate with healthcare institutions, nursing schools, and industry influencers to build early membership. Referral incentives encourage members to invite colleagues, which drives organic growth through trusted networks.

SEO optimization with relevant keywords ensures healthcare professionals can find your platform through search. A blog with practical healthcare career and clinical topics builds long-term organic traffic.

How to Scale Your Community

As the community grows, expand features to match member needs: job boards, mentorship matching, certification courses, and continuing education resources. The flexibility of WordPress lets you add these over time without rebuilding the platform from scratch.
